Unmatched Long-Range Night Vision Capability

Traditional infrared (IR) cameras are limited by LED array illumination, often struggling beyond 100-200 meters. The core innovation of a laser PTZ camera lies in its use of an integrated laser illuminator. This powerful, focused beam of infrared light can project over several kilometers, illuminating distant targets with incredible clarity where other cameras see only darkness. This makes them perfect for borders, ports, large perimeters, and energy facilities.

Precision Pan-Tilt-Zoom (PTZ) Control

Paired with the powerful laser is a high-performance PTZ mechanism. Operators can pan 360 degrees, tilt across a wide vertical range, and utilize high-optical-zoom lenses to pinpoint and track subjects miles away with precise detail. The synergy of long-range laser illumination and powerful zoom creates an unparalleled surveillance tool for proactive threat detection.

Key Features and Applications

Modern laser PTZ cameras offer more than just night vision. Key features include intelligent video analytics (like intrusion detection and auto-tracking), robust weatherproof housing (IP66/IP67 rated), and advanced image stabilization for clear viewing even in high winds. They are essential for:

• Critical Infrastructure: Protecting power plants, dams, and communication towers.

• Border & Coastal Surveillance: Monitoring vast, unlit areas for unauthorized activity.

• Large Industrial Sites: Securing refineries, mining operations, and logistics yards.

Frequently Asked Questions (FAQ)

Q: What is the maximum range of a laser PTZ camera?

A: Ranges vary by model, but advanced systems can provide clear identification of human targets at distances exceeding 2 kilometers in total darkness.

Q: How does it differ from a thermal camera?

A: Thermal cameras detect heat signatures and are excellent for presence detection. A laser ptz camera provides actual detailed visual imagery at night, allowing for identification of faces, license plates, and other critical details that thermal cannot.

Q: Are they difficult to install and configure?

A: While professional installation is recommended for optimal calibration, many modern units are designed with user-friendly network interfaces and software for straightforward setup and control.
